
Market Size and Trends
The Artificial Intelligence Integration Platform is estimated to be valued at USD 7.2 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 19.8 billion by 2033,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 14.5% from 2026 to 2033. This significant growth reflects increasing adoption across industries, driven by advancements in AI technologies and the rising need for seamless integration of AI solutions into existing business processes, enhancing operational efficiency and decision-making capabilities.
The market trend for Artificial Intelligence Integration Platforms is characterized by expanding applications in sectors such as healthcare, finance, and manufacturing, where real-time data processing and automation are critical. Additionally, there is a growing emphasis on developing user-friendly platforms that support multi-cloud environments and enable interoperability between various AI tools. The integration of AI with IoT and big data analytics further accelerates demand, as organizations seek to harness insights from diverse data sources for competitive advantage.
Segmental Analysis:
By Deployment Type: Dominance of Cloud-Based Solutions Driven by Scalability and Flexibility
In terms of By Deployment Type, Cloud-Based solutions contribute the highest share of the Artificial Intelligence Integration Platform market owing to their inherent scalability,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ness. Organizations increasingly prefer cloud-based deployments as they enable rapid integration of AI technologies without the need for significant upfront infrastructure investments. The cloud environment offers seamless accessibility to AI tools and resources, facilitating real-time data processing and AI model deployment across geographically dispersed teams. This ease of deployment accelerates innovation cycles and reduces time-to-market for AI-driven applications. Furthermore, cloud platforms provide robust security frameworks, continuous updates, and compliance support, which are critical for industries handling sensitive data. The flexibility to scale resources based on dynamic workload demands also ensures that enterprises optimize their operational costs while maintaining performance. Hybrid and edge computing models complement cloud-based deployments by addressing latency and data sovereignty concerns; however, the dominance of cloud solutions persists due to their central role in managing complex AI workloads and supporting collaboration between AI components. This widespread adoption is further reinforced by the growing availability of cloud-native AI integration platforms that simplify AI orchestration, management, and monitoring, making them attractive for businesses aiming to leverage AI capabilities efficiently.
By Application: Customer Experience Management Leads with AI-Driven Personalization and Automation
In terms of By Application, Customer Experience Management (CEM) holds the leading share within the Artificial Intelligence Integration Platform market. The growth in this segment is primarily fueled by increasing demands for personalized customer interactions and advanced automation technologies. Businesses across sectors are leveraging AI to analyze vast amounts of customer data, enabling more accurate predictions of customer preferences, behaviors, and needs. This deep understanding allows brands to create highly tailored experiences through targeted marketing, adaptive customer service chatbots, and intelligent recommendation systems. The rise in digital channels and e-commerce has intensified the need for rapid, responsive, and consistent customer engagement, which AI-powered integration platforms facilitate by connecting disparate data sources and communication touchpoints into a unified ecosystem. Additionally, automation of routine interactions and proactive service through predictive analytics reduces response times and operational costs, enhancing overall customer satisfaction and loyalty. The ability to continuously learn and adapt from live interactions makes AI-driven CEM an indispensable segment of AI integration platforms. The pressure to improve customer retention and acquisition in a competitive market environment continues to fuel demand for these sophisticated AI capabilities.
By End-User Industry: Healthcare's Predominance Due to AI's Transformative Impact on Patient Care
In terms of By End-User Industry, Healthcare commands the largest share of the Artificial Intelligence Integration Platform market, driven by the transformative potential of AI in enhancing patient outcomes and operational efficiency. The healthcare sector faces increasing challenges such as rising costs, demand for personalized treatment, and the need for faster, more accurate diagnosis. AI integration platforms enable healthcare providers to consolidate clinical data, medical imaging, electronic health records, and genomics, creating an interconnected ecosystem for AI algorithms to deliver actionable insights. These platforms facilitate applications such as predictive diagnostics, treatment recommendations, resource optimization, and patient monitoring. Moreover, the surge in telemedicine and remote patient care has accelerated the adoption of AI solutions that seamlessly integrate wearable device data and real-time monitoring systems. Regulatory focus on improving healthcare quality and patient safety amplifies the need for trusted AI deployment platforms that ensure compliance and data security. The capacity of AI to assist clinicians in early disease detection, personalized medicine, and workflow automation cements healthcare as the foremost end-user industry for AI integration platforms. As healthcare continues to embrace digital transformation, the integration of AI into existing systems remains critical for delivering next-generation care and operational excellence.
Regional Insights:
Dominating Region: North America
In North America, the dominance in the Artificial Intelligence Integration Platform market is driven by a robust technology ecosystem, advanced R&D capabilities, and strong collaboration between industry and academia. The presence of major technology hubs such as Silicon Valley and Boston fosters continuous innovation and adoption of AI integration solutions across various industries including healthcare, finance, and manufacturing. Proactive government initiatives supporting AI development and digital transformation further strengthen this leadership position. Leading companies like IBM, Microsoft, Google, and NVIDIA contribute significantly through their AI platforms and cloud services that facilitate seamless integration of AI across enterprises. The mature market infrastructure and established trade relations also enable smooth deployment and scaling of AI integration technologies in this region.
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ific
Meanwhile, the Asia Pacific exhibits the fastest growth in the Artificial Intelligence Integration Platform market, propelled by rapidly expanding digital economies, increasing investments in AI technologies, and government policies aimed at fostering innovation and smart city initiatives. Countries like China, India, Japan, and South Korea have intensified focus on AI-driven automation, with government-backed programs accelerating integration platform development. The vast industrial base and growing startup ecosystem amplify demand for customized AI integration solutions tailored to diverse market needs. Notable players such as Alibaba Cloud, Baidu, Tencent, and Samsung actively contribute to market expansion by offering comprehensive AI platforms that support a wide range of applications from e-commerce to industrial automation. Additionally, trade liberalization and growing partnerships between local and global firms facilitate technology transfer and market penetration.
Artificial Intelligence Integration Platform Market Outlook for Key Countries
United States
The United States' market is characterized by strong innovation capabilities and a highly developed IT infrastructure. Major players such as Microsoft Azure, IBM Watson, and Google Cloud provide advanced AI integration platforms that enable enterprises to embed AI into their existing applications efficiently. Government initiatives like the National AI Initiative Act support the commercialization and ethical deployment of AI technologies which further catalyze market penetration. The dynamic startup ecosystem also fuels experimentation and rapid adoption of AI integration across verticals including healthcare, defense, and finance.
China
China is a powerhouse in AI integration platforms driven by extensive government support through the "New Generation AI Development Plan" and significant private-sector investment. Companies like Alibaba Cloud, Baidu AI, and Huawei Cloud are aggressively expanding their AI integration services, leveraging large datasets and cutting-edge AI models. The focus on smart manufacturing, smart cities, and digital finance has led to high demand for scalable AI platforms that integrate multiple AI capabilities. The country's strong manufacturing sector and digital transformation strategies contribute to the growing adoption of AI integration solutions.
Germany
Germany continues to lead in integrating AI platforms within its well-established manufacturing and automotive industries, often referred to as Industry 4.0. Siemens, SAP, and Bosch are pivotal players offering AI integration platforms that enable predictive maintenance, robotics automation, and supply chain optimization. Germany's emphasis on data privacy and regulatory compliance shapes the development of secure and interoperable AI integration solutions. Collaborative government-industry initiatives promote AI adoption in traditional sectors while balancing innovation with regulatory oversight.
India
India's market is evolving rapidly, buoyed by increasing digital infrastructure and startups specializing in AI-driven business solutions. Companies such as Infosys, TCS, and Wipro are enhancing their AI platform capabilities to serve sectors like IT services, telecommunications, and BFSI (Banking, Financial Services, and Insurance). Government programs such as Digital India and AI-focused research centers are accelerating adoption by promoting skill development and fostering innovation. The demand for cost-effective AI integration solutions tailored for SMEs and new-age industries fuels market momentum.
Japan
Japan's market benefits from a strong industrial base and a government commitment to AI as part of its Society 5.0 initiative. Companies like Fujitsu, NEC, and Hitachi are investing heavily in AI integration platforms to drive automation in manufacturing, robotics, and healthcare. The aging population and labor shortages motivate implementation of AI-integrated systems to improve productivity and quality of life. Japan's focus on harmonizing AI integration with ethical standards and cybersecurity ensures reliable and sustainable market growth.
